The Story of Aleksi
As a girl name
The earliest SSA record of Aleksi as a girl name dates back to 1996, when 5 babies received it. 2001 was its biggest year on record, with 7 newborns named Aleksi — #12,056 in the national rankings. About 43% of every Aleksi on record arrived during the 2000s, its defining decade. Aleksi last appeared in the published SSA data in 2014, with 5 recorded births — it has not charted nationally since. All told, over 28 Americans have carried the name since 1880, from the 1990s to the 2020s.
As a boy name
American parents first put Aleksi on the record books as a boy name in 1996, with 7 registered babies. Its peak popularity came in 2023, when 10 Aleksis were born — ranking #7,734 that year. About 38% of every Aleksi on record arrived during the 2000s, its defining decade. Aleksi last appeared in the published SSA data in 2023, with 10 recorded births — it has not charted nationally since. All told, over 90 Americans have carried the name since 1880, from the 1990s to the 2020s.
